OK, I mounted the CD-ROM and looked for copyright statements. The only one I found was /COPYRGHT.TXT, a modified 8 paragraph BSD license with \r\n line delimiters, attached. Arguably it only applies to the OS sources, but it's the only license I can see. It probibits commercial distributions, but the important clause from our point of view is: * 5. Non-commercial distribution of the complete source and/or binary * release at no charge to the user (such as from an official Internet * archive site) is permitted. I was going to take out just the source tree, but another clause states: * 7. Non-commercial and/or commercial distribution of an incomplete, * altered, or otherwise modified source and/or binary release is not * permitted. Since this is the only copyright statement, I assume that this means I can put up the entire CD image, but not just part of it, so that's what I've done.
